If your double glazing windows are damaged it is recommended to repair them as soon as possible. If the seals have been damaged, it can cause draughts and condensation, and make your house less efficient in energy use.

The good news is that repairing double glazing is usually less expensive than replacing it. This article will discuss some of the most frequent problems with double-glazed windows and ways to fix them.

Cost

Double glazing is a great method to keep heat in and lower energy costs. However, over time the windows will become less effective. This is typically due to a broken seal or condensation between the glass panes. Fortunately, these problems can be resolved without having to replace the windows. In certain cases however, replacement is the only option. This could be the case when there are several damaged panes and massive frame rot.

The cost to repair double-glazed glass windows will vary based on the type and size broken pane. The frame and sash might also require repair. The cost of the repair will also depend on the labor and materials required to complete the task. A glazier will be capable of providing an estimate for the repairs required.

Many homeowners are in a quandary about whether or not to replace their double-glazed windows. While it is possible to do the work yourself, it's generally more efficient and economical to employ professionals. A professional will also offer an assurance on their work, which you won't get with a DIY fix.

Condensation between the glass panes is one of the most common problems with double-glazed windows. This is due to the seal on the double-glazed window unit breaking, allowing moisture to enter the window gap. If not treated, this could lead to condensation and even leaks from water. A glazier can help by drilling small holes into the window to let out the moisture. After the moisture is expelled, the window is resealed.

Double-glazed windows can be difficult to open or close. This can be due to an occasional stretching of the frame, or it could simply be an issue with the hinges or locks. In either case, a glazier can replace the handles or hinges to make them functional again.

Double-glazed windows are a great option for homes with colder climates. They are more energy-efficient and long-lasting than single-glazed windows. They are less susceptible to intruders. Apart from these benefits they also can increase the value of a home.

Condensation

Condensation can be an indication that the seals are broken and water has gotten in. Although it's not necessarily a big deal but it is advisable to fix the issue immediately you notice it. This will stop the condensation from spreading and causing damage to your frame, which could result in dampness or mould. There are a variety of ways to fix this problem, but the most effective option is to put air bricks and vents in your windows and doors. These air bricks and vents will allow fresh air to enter but will not let the warm air in your home escape.

Double glazing condensation is caused by the glass having a lower surface than the air. This is due to the gas that acts as an insulator between the panes. The air inside is humid and warm and will stick to the glass and create droplets of water. This issue is more frequent in the early morning and at night when the dewpoint is lower than the temperature of the glass.

Over time, the window seals are prone to breaking due to wear and wear and. This is more common with older double glazing units as the seals tend to be thinner. Depending on the severity of the problem, you may be able to save money by replacing the seals rather than replacing the whole window.

Dehumidifiers can also be used to stop condensation from occurring in the room with the windows. This will eliminate the excess moisture from the air, Window Repairs which will decrease the humidity. In addition, it is also important to keep the space ventilated and to avoid letting too much heat escape through windows.

If your windows are covered by warranty, you should contact the company that installed them to report the problem. This will speed up the repair process and ensure that you are not paying for an item that isn't functioning as it should. It is essential not to tamper with your units as this could invalidate your warranty.

Frames

The frames of double-glazed windows are important not just for aesthetics, but also for the thermal efficiency of windows. A quality frame will have a Uw-value less than the glass. The best options for energy efficiency are aluminum-clad vinyl, and upvc window repairs. The frame should be correctly installed and maintained to prevent water damage, leaks, or condensation.

A frayed frame can lead to drafts and a loss of energy efficiency. Fortunately, the majority of frames can be fixed easily with some wood screws and glue. However, it's an ideal idea to use counter bored screws for the corners, which can help prevent the wood from splitting. The screws should not be driven so that they push against the trim, which is usually fragile.

A common double glazing problem is that the seal could break between the glass panes. This is due to condensation, which creates moisture in the gaps between the panes of the glass. The seal can be repaired if it is not damaged in any way however, in extreme instances, it could be required to replace the entire glass unit.

Keeping the frames of your double glazed windows in good shape will help to prevent damage and extend their life. This will save you money in the end and will improve the overall appearance of your home. This can be achieved by selecting frames that are easy to clean. uPVC is easiest to keep clean, and has no grooves where water or dirt can accumulate. Other materials such as timber or aluminum require more maintenance, and can rot or rust in the wrong way if not treated properly.

It is not advised to try replacing a window with double panes on your own. To replace a double pane window, you'll need have special tools and know how to remove and replace the old glass. Additionally, you'll have to distinguish the different kinds of double-glazed windows as well as their functions.
